What is Oil-Dri of America EPS (Diluted)?

Oil-Dri of America ODC -2.49% 65 EPS (Diluted) is $3.82 as of Apr. 2026. GuruFocus rates ODC with a GF Score™ of 65/100 and a GF Value™ of $44.32 (Significantly Overvalued).

Oil-Dri of America's Earnings per Share (Diluted) for the three months ended in Apr. 2026 was $1.00. Earnings per Share (Diluted) for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Apr. 2026 was $3.82.

Oil-Dri of America's EPS (Basic) for the three months ended in Apr. 2026 was $1.08. Its EPS (Basic) for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Apr. 2026 was $4.12.

Oil-Dri of America's EPS without NRI for the three months ended in Apr. 2026 was $1.00. Its EPS without NRI for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Apr. 2026 was $3.82.

During the past 12 months, Oil-Dri of America's average EPS without NRIGrowth Rate was 12.00% per year. During the past 3 years, the average EPS without NRIGrowth Rate was 72.10% per year. During the past 5 years, the average EPS without NRI Growth Rate was 33.10% per year. During the past 10 years, the average EPS without NRI Growth Rate was 15.20% per year. Oil-Dri of America  (NYSE:ODC) EPS (Diluted) Explanation

EPS is the single most important variable used by Wall Street in determining the earnings power of a company. But investors need to be aware that Earnings per Share can be easily manipulated by adjusting depreciation and amortization rate or non-recurring items. That's why GuruFocus lists EPS without NRI, which better reflects the company's underlying performance.


Be Aware

Compared with Earnings per share, a company's cash flow is better indicator of the company's earnings power.

If a company's earnings per share is less than cash flow per share over long term, investors need to be cautious and find out why.

Oil-Dri of America EPS (Diluted) Calculation

EPS (Diluted) is a rough measurement of the amount of a company's profit that can be allocated to one share of its stock. Diluted EPS takes into account all of the outstanding dilutive securities that could potentially be exercised (such as stock options and convertible preferred stock) and shows how such an action would impact earnings per share.

Oil-Dri of America's Diluted EPS for the fiscal year that ended in Jul. 2025 is calculated as

Diluted EPS (A: Jul. 2025 ) = (Net Income - Preferred Dividends) / Shares Outstanding (Diluted Average)
=(53.996-0)/17.877
=3.02

Oil-Dri of America's Diluted EPS for the quarter that ended in Apr. 2026 is calculated as

Diluted EPS (Q: Apr. 2026 )=(Net Income - Preferred Dividends) / Shares Outstanding (Diluted Average)
=(14.526-0)/17.944
=0.81

EPS (Diluted) for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Apr. 2026 adds up the quarterly data reported by the company within the most recent 12 months, which was $3.82

Oil-Dri of America Business Description

Other Exchanges O4D:Germany
Address 410 North Michigan Avenue, Suite 400, Chicago, IL, USA, 60611-4213
Oil-Dri Corp of America develops, manufactures, and markets sorbent products made predominantly from clay. Its absorbent offerings, which draw liquid up, include cat litter, floor products, toxin control substances for livestock, and agricultural chemical carriers. The company has two segments based on the different characteristics of two primary customer groups, namely the Retail and Wholesale Products Group, which derives maximum revenue, and the Business-to-Business Products Group. The company's products are sold under various brands such as Cat's Pride, Jonny Cat, Amlan, Agsorb, Verge, Pure-Flo, and Ultra-Clear.
